Output 484cdb8515afea74a5e6691c7a7bc8e314aa672e1db18daf8e598e723d914bed:3

value
311226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de24632c6ede649ea7d9945dcf5d6e2f35e65c3c OP_EQUAL
address
3MwbXNTUaAKSifgYh2aSTZBq1o7RLzCfEN
transaction
484cdb8515afea74a5e6691c7a7bc8e314aa672e1db18daf8e598e723d914bed
confirmations
158413
spent
true